Conditions

Abdominal pain during a painless colonoscopy

Interventions

Experiment group 1:Nalbuphine was given before examination
Experiment group 2:Oxycodone was given before examination
control group:Fentanyl was given before examination

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: Inclusion criteria 1) Fibercolonoscopy was performed; 2) The patient voluntarily requested intravenous anesthesia; 3) Regardless of gender, age 18-65 years old; 4)ASA? or ? level; 5) Sign informed consent

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: Exclusion criteria 1) The patient has a history of neurological disease or mental illness and a history of drug allergy; 2) Surgical history within 1 month; 3) History of long-term use of analgesic drugs or other history of taking drugs that affect the test results; 4) A history of uncontrolled hypertension, arrhythmia, and heart failure; 5) History of obstructive sleep apnea (OSA), acute upper respiratory tract infection, asthma and other respiratory diseases; 6) According to the judgment of the investigator, patients who are not suitable for participation in this study for any reason other than the inclusion criteria and exclusion criteria.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Total use of analgesics (nalbuphine, oxycodone, fentanyl) /mg;

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
MAP;HR;SpO2;Breathing (whether mask pressure is required for oxygen/trachea intubation);body motion grade;Whether restless or not;
